Daily Devotion:
"The Joy of God's Gift"
Ecclesiastes 5:20
New Living Translation
20 God keeps such people so busy enjoying life that they take no time to brood over the past.
Ecclesiastes 5:20 says, "They seldom reflect on the days of their life, because God keeps them occupied with gladness of heart." This verse invites us to ponder the fleeting nature of life and the importance of gratitude.
In our fast-paced world, it's easy to get caught up in our daily tasks and worries, forgetting to appreciate the blessings around us. The writer of Ecclesiastes encourages us to pause and recognize the joy and gladness that God provides. When we actively reflect on our lives, we begin to see how even small moments can be filled with God's grace.
Consider setting aside time each day to reflect on your experiences, noticing the good amidst the challenges. As you do this, invite God into your reflections and seek to understand His hand in your life. Remember, joy isn’t just about happiness; it’s about a deeper connection with God and recognizing His presence.
Allow His gladness to fill your heart, and share that joy with others. In doing so, we cultivate a thankful spirit and a more profound appreciation for the gift of life.
